Hello, I have been using ciao for some time now, and this time I'm really stuck :-) I would like to use a variable in a head (as I used to do in WinProlog, for example). The problem is I cannot get it to compile, so I guess that I'm forgetting some switch or doing something completely stupid...
Specifically, this is the rule I want to define:
traverseComponent(Environment, Process, Component) :- Process(Component, Environment).
Resulting in the following compile error:
ERROR: (lns 408-411) syntax error: , or ) expected in arguments traverseComponent ( Environment , Process , Component ) :- call ( Process ** here ** ( Component , Environment ) ) . }
